Job Description

The Role

As a Legal Project Analyst, you will have an impact on how we provide the best-in-class service delivery through our legal project management capabilities to our lawyers and support the Legal Project Managers (LPMs) on large and complex projects/matters.
 

Who you will work with

Legal Project Management Team sits within our "Best Delivery" hubs which are aligned to global business units of Corporate, Global Financial Markets and Litigation & Dispute Resolution. The purpose of Best Delivery is to ensure that we can deliver an outstanding client experience on every matter, every time. Our application of continuous improvement principles, smart technology and the most efficient and effective resources are all geared to improving outcomes for our clients' business. It is an established and critical strand to our Innovation change programme with far-reaching global coverage.
 

What you will be responsible for

You will collaborate closely with LPMs and work in coordination with Legal Support Secretaries, as well as various other teams including the billing team, GPMS IT, Legal technology advisors, and continuous improvement teams to offer financial and project/matter management support for various matters. Building strong relationships with LPMs, partners, and lawyers will be essential in this role.
 

What you will do

Commercial Support

  • Preparing fee reports for internal and external clients
  • Tracking project workstreams, preparing budget and forecasting using fee reports to make recommendations to the legal team.
  • Conduct analysis on data, such as leverage and profitability calculations, and carry out burn rate and run rate analysis on projects.

Technical Support

  • Using defined templates, SOPs and tools to produce reports useful for the matter team.
  • Using existing reports and systems available in Clifford Chance to provide best-in-class project management support and improve the overall service delivery.
  • Understanding matter processes and how they could be improved, and creating a tool, to address the need.
  • Working on Clifford Chance Best Delivery tools such as CC Connect and KIRA etc in updating fee reports, extending accesses to the site to the matter team, third parties and client, uploading and downloading of documents.

Financial Support

  • Drafting and circulating time recording guidelines to matter teams, considering appropriate time recording practices and client-specific requirements.
  • Tracking CC and third-party fees against budgets/fee estimates for the File Partner, Managing Associate and client.
  •  Provide a suite of financial and profitability reporting.

Matter Support and Coordination

  • Reviewing draft invoices, and identifying and checking amendments.
  • Attending CC matter team meetings and client calls, preparing meeting agendas, and drafting and circulating actions following meetings.
  • Assist in tracking Out of Scope work by reviewing Action Log and by analysing timesheets submitted by lawyers on a matter.
  • Assist in keeping a track of breach of assumptions mentioned in the engagement letter/contract.
  • Preparing Resource planner, Working Parties List
  • Providing useful analysis using profitability dashboards for crucial decision making for partners.
  • Assisting project managers with organizing and controlling project activities.
  • Organising communications among the CC and client teams such contacts lists, distribution lists, absence planning and access to key documents.
